Barrel N Brew – Corowa, NSW

A rustic café with flair, Barrel N Brew on Sanger Street is a must-visit in Corowa for those who appreciate hearty yet refined café fare. Whether you’re basking in the alfresco seating on a balmy afternoon or cosying up inside with the warm glow of Edison drop lighting, this café exudes country charm. Known for its generous breakfasts and standout lunch options, it’s also a hidden gem when it comes to bar snacks.

For a light yet satisfying bite, the seafood platter is a winning choice, featuring a crispy medley of calamari, prawn twists and squid, served with golden wedges and a selection of house-made dipping sauces. It’s the ideal dish to share alongside an ice-cold beer or a glass of local wine from the Riverina region.

St Siandra – Mosman, NSW

Perched on a private beach at The Spit, St Siandra is the kind of place that makes every day feel like a Mediterranean holiday. With panoramic views of crystal-clear turquoise waters and an atmosphere that oozes coastal elegance, this restaurant and bar delivers the perfect blend of relaxation and indulgence. Whether you’re here for a long lunch or a sundown session with Champagne, the menu is all about fresh, vibrant produce and seafood-forward flavours.

Kick things off with a tuna crudo, where delicate slices of tuna meet creamy avocado, green chilli, fragrant baharat and a citrus vinaigrette that ties it all together with a bright, zesty punch. It’s the kind of dish that transports you straight to the Greek Isles with every bite.

Vale Restaurant & Bar – McLaren Flat, SA

Set within Vale Brewery, this McLaren Flat dining spot is where craft beer meets sophisticated cuisine. Floor-to-ceiling glass windows provide stunning vineyard views, making it an ideal setting to sip on a locally brewed ale while indulging in some expertly crafted small plates. With a menu that champions premium local produce, this is a place to linger over bites designed to complement the region’s best drops.

For an elegant take on bar snacks, try the beef tartare, a finely balanced dish featuring hand-cut beef, crispy potato pave, wattle seed mayo and salted duck egg. It’s rich, textural and full of umami depth—exactly the kind of bite you want alongside a robust red wine or a crisp, cold beer straight from the source.

 

Calypso Club – Cairns, QLD

Bringing tropical holiday vibes to the Cairns Esplanade, Calypso Club is a playful yet elegant rum bar and seafood kitchen that takes inspiration from European seaside tavernas and American crab shacks. With a soundtrack that sets the mood and cocktails that highlight fresh tropical fruits, it’s the ultimate escape for those looking to embrace the coastal lifestyle.

For an impressive sharing plate, order the Calypso Chilled Platter, a seafood lover’s dream featuring oysters, prawns, gravlax rainbow trout, tuna sashimi, bug tail and seaweed salad, accompanied by an array of dipping sauces and condiments. It’s a feast of ocean-fresh flavours, best enjoyed with a classic piña colada or a rum-spiked daiquiri.
